ZAE000043485 – JSE share code: ANG CUSIP: 035128206 – NYSE share code: AU (“AngloGold Ashanti” or the “Company”) NEWS RELEASE DEALINGS IN SECURITIES BY AN EXECUTIVE DIRECTOR AND THE COMPANY SECRETARY OF ANGLOGOLD ASHANTI LIMITED In terms of paragraph 3.63 of the JSE Limited Listings Requirements (JSE Listings Requirements), AngloGold Ashanti gives notice that an executive director and the company secretary have dealt in ordinary shares of the Company, after having received clearance to do so in terms of paragraph 3.66 of the JSE Listings Requirements. The transactions were pursuant to a Co-Investment Plan (CIP) for the Company’s executives. In terms of the CIP, executives are allowed to apply up to 50% of their after-tax cash bonus to purchase AngloGold Ashanti ordinary shares. The Company then matches their investment at 150% through an on- market purchase of shares, with vesting over a two-year period in two equal tranches; the first vesting date being the anniversary of the date on which the executive purchased the shares and the second vesting date being the second anniversary of the date on which the executive purchased the shares. The executive director opted to participate in the CIP in 2018.
